What Is a Drum Circle Activity and Why Is It So Effective?
At its core, a Drum Circle Activity is a group experience where individuals play percussion instruments in rhythm with one another. But beyond the beats and hand drums lies a much deeper goal—creating unity through collective participation.
When teams engage in a Drum Circle Workshop, they break down personal walls, shed formal titles, and communicate non-verbally through music. The focus is on synchronization, listening, and mutual respect—essential ingredients for any successful team.
Studies show that rhythmic drumming enhances mood, reduces stress, and improves focus. The collective experience of working toward a shared sound mirrors the dynamics of working toward shared business goals.

Inside the Drum Circle Workshop: What to Expect
Curious about what actually happens in a Drum Circle Workshop? Here’s a step-by-step breakdown of the experience:
1. Warm-Up and Introduction
The session begins with light stretching and rhythmic clapping to warm up both the body and the mind. Facilitators introduce basic drumming techniques and set the tone for inclusivity and openness.
2. Instrument Distribution
Participants are handed a variety of percussion instruments—djembes, bongos, tambourines, shakers—each chosen to represent diversity and individuality within a team.
3. Rhythm Building
The group gradually builds up rhythm layers. Some sections play the base beat while others add accents and fills. Each rhythm is like a department in your company—distinct yet vital to the whole.
4. Improvisation and Collaboration
This is where leadership, creativity, and active listening come alive. Individuals may be asked to lead sections, change the tempo, or introduce new rhythms—just like taking initiative in a project or adapting to change in the workplace.
5. Grand Finale
The session ends with a powerful crescendo—a celebration of collective achievement. Participants are left with a sense of pride, unity, and elevated energy.
The beauty of the drum circle team building lies in its metaphor. The journey from chaos to cohesion mirrors the real-world process of becoming a high-performing team

Why Drum Circles Are More Than Just a Trend
While team-building trends come and go, corporate drumming events are rooted in ancient human behavior. Cultures across Africa, Asia, and the Americas have long used drumming circles for healing, bonding, and celebration.
The resurgence of this activity in the corporate world is not just a fad—it’s a return to something deeply human. Drumming bypasses logic and speaks directly to the soul. And in an era dominated by screens and data, that connection is more valuable than ever.
